Product features : Domaine Chiroulet Soleil d'Automne – Côtes de Gascogne Blanc Moelleux 2024

Breeding
Ageing in stainless steel on fine lees to preserve aromatic purity and crisp fruit character
On the eye
Pale golden yellow with greenish glints
On the nose
Fresh orchard fruit mingling with dried apricot and subtle honeyed notes, creating an inviting aromatic profile without cloying sweetness
In the mouth
Elegant and well-balanced, with citrus notes providing tension against the wine's inherent sweetness. Charming and refreshing, it invites a second glass rather than overwhelming the palate

DOMAINE CHIROULET

Domaine Chiroulet is a family wine estate in the Gers, Côtes de Gascogne (South-West France). Founded by the Fezas family. Around 60 hectares on clay-limestone soils. Grapes: Colombard, Sauvignon Blanc, Gros Manseng, Petit Manseng (whites), Tannat, Merlot (reds). Dry whites, sweet whites and sparkling wines. Available at Les Halles de Quercamps.
